Recorded 17 January 2025.
The potential for factor-based investing to one day be applied to digital assets, has long been a tantalizing prospect.
But it’s not been possible - till now.
CF Benchmarks’ recent report - ‘A Factor Model for Digital Assets’ - demonstrated the existence of ‘classic’ asset market behaviour patterns (factors), like Momentum, Liquidity, Value and others, within the crypto asset class, beyond any reasonable doubt.
For the clearest possible exploration of the research, the CFB Talks Digital Assets team were stoked to welcome CF Benchmarks quant and product manager Cristian Isac, back to the podcast.
Listen in to 5x your understanding of Crypto Factors.
Key points include....
• The quickening pace of institutional participation, and why it means the time for a digital asset factor model is now
• How classic models like CAPM and Fama-French were adapted for use on crypto’s unique dynamics
• Surmounting the data quality challenge: observations across rebalances, universes, and monetary regimes
• Impressive results; e.g.: Size - risk premium: ~9% annualised; Sharpe: 0.5; Growth - risk premium: ~25% annualised; Sharpe: ~ 1.5
All in all, this episode should be essential listening for quants, portfolio managers, and investment professionals in general; anyone, in fact, serious about the evolution of digital asset investing.
